Latest Patents

Among his notable inventions, the latest are focused on a tetravalent dengue vaccine. The invention provides a recombinant polypeptide comprising the EDIII domain of each of the four dengue virus serotypes: DENV-1, DENV-2, DENV-3, and DENV-4. This innovative approach links these domains to the N-terminal of HBsAg, showcasing Khanna's cutting-edge work in immunology.
